Packed by your first victory in the UFC, Patrick Pitbull doesn't want to waste time in the world's biggest organization. After a bitter debut in UFC 314, in which he was defeated by unanimous decision to Yair Rodriguez, the potiguar turned things around by beating Dan Ige at UFC 318. Now, at 38 years old, he wants to return to the octagon as soon as possible and promised news to his fans.

In a post on 'X' (formerly Twitter), Patrício stated that he is ready to return to fighting and that he has communicated his availability to the UFC after a brief break for rest. The fighter is awaiting confirmation of his next fight.

"I took a week off after my last fight and have returned to training. I told the UFC I'm ready to fight and hope to hear from them soon," he wrote. Patricio pitbull.

Furthermore, Pitbull made himself available to replace athletes in fights already scheduled in UFC 319, at UFC China and UFC Night, reinforcing your interest in any of these opportunities.

"I'll also be ready to step in if they need a replacement for Pico vs. Murphy, Sterling vs. Ortega, or Lopes vs. Silva. Which fight would you like?" concluded the former Bellator champion.

Considered one of the greatest fighters in Bellator history, Patrick Pitbull failed to show his best performance in his UFC debut. The Brazilian struggled to impose his game and ended up defeated by Yair Rodriguez by unanimous decision. In the following fight, the Rio Grande do Norte native recovered by winning Dan Ige, also in the final, guaranteeing his position as 11th in the featherweight category (up to 65,7 kg).

There is great anticipation among fans that the third fight of Patrick Pitbull in Ultimate will take place at UFC Rio, scheduled for October 11th. If this is confirmed, the former Bellator champion will be an important reinforcement for the card, which will have Charles of the Bronx as the main highlight.
